The All for Literacy podcast, hosted by Dr. Liz Brooke, connects you with established and emerging voices in the national literacy conversation to map a path forward informed by science of reading. Through monthly episodes, this series forges connections between literacy research, educators’ knowledge and skills, and the implementation into classroom instruction. This is a conversation, empowering educators with the science of teaching reading. All for Literacy brings together researchers, educators, and experts to elevate literacy in America and create real equity in the classroom.

The Science of Reading Policy Status With Casey Sullivan Taylor
The best intervention is prevention, explains Casey Sullivan Taylor, policy director for early literacy for ExcelinEd. The former reading teacher, interventionist, and literacy coach joins All For Literacy host Dr. Liz Brooke for an in-depth exploration of how literacy policy trickles down into district evolution, professional development programs, and classroom activities with one ultimate goal—driving student success.
